• Delivery times may vary based on location.#@@#deliverynotes#@#NA#@@#Maintenance Guide#@#Inspect burners weekly and remove debris to maintain consistent flame and heat output. Clean stainless steel surfaces with a neutral detergent and soft cloth; rinse and dry to prevent spotting. Check pilot and ignition ports monthly and clear obstructions using compressed air. Verify door seals and cabinet fasteners quarterly and tighten as required. Calibrate gas pressure and test for leaks per CSA guidelines before each heavy service period.
